Bioluminescence Tour & Sunset River Cruise
The Sittee River is the gateway to one of nature’s breathtaking phenomena – bioluminescent or “burning wata” as the Belizeans call it. This night tour is seasonal. Conditions have to be just perfect in the Anderson Lagoon and it usually occurs in the driest months like February - April. Head out on the 5 minute boat ride to Anderson Lagoon on the Sittee River. The night sky is UNBELIEVABLE. Thick with stars all the way down to the tree line.

Barrier Reef Snorkel: Half Day
The UNESCO listed the Great Belize Barrier Reef as one of the most diverse eco-systems in the world made up of over 100 coral species and home to some 500 species of fish and hundreds of invertebrates. Our snorkeling tour takes you on a 30-40 minutes boat ride to the Southern Barrier Reef which offers several different snorkeling sites within the reserve for beginners and experienced snorkelers.
Garifuna Cultural and Culinary Experience in Hopkins Belize
Dive into the most interactive, fun and educational Garifuna Cultural & Culinary Experience in Belize. Visit Kalipuna Cultural Heritage Island a unique destination designated for the preservation of Garifuna Culture and share and learn from passionate and knowledgeable afro-indigenous advocates by participating in hands on cooking classes learning authentic & traditional Garifuna recipes and cooking methods. Chit chat about Garifuna History with knowledgable elders. Explore the lush herbal garden and learning about herbs used for both recreation and medicinal purposes. Savor the fruits of your labor as you enjoy a mouthwatering Garifuna meal. Every bite tells a story, connecting you to the flavors of this vibrant culture. Cultural dishes can be customize so that guests with special dietary restrictions can also enjoy. Conclude your day with a mesmerizing Garifuna drumming session led by our master drumming instructor.
Traditional Chocolate Making in Belize
At a local cacao farm, you’ll be able to see cacao pods fresh off the tree with the seed still covered in sweet fleshy fruit. You’ll be taken through the entire process of traditional chocolate making which includes grinding the cacao into a paste with a mortar and pestle. You will learn about the history and significance of cacao in the Mayan culture, including its use as currency. The chocolate paste you created will set in the fridge and you’ll be able to taste organic chocolate, handmade by you, straight from the source.

Cave Tubing at Saint Herman's Cave
The tour starts with a 10 minute walk through the jungle as you get an informative talk on cave archaeology and the geology of the Maya Mountains. You then get to spend about two hours inside the cave system. Enter the exciting world of rivers disappearing into the “underworld” as you float on inner tubes with only your head lamp to light your way.
